Obituary of Maria Dwyer

Please share a memory of Maria to include in a keepsake book for family and friends.
Our mom, Maria Scotti Dwyer, has embarked on her eternal journey, reunited with her father. Born on February 27th, 1931, in New York City, she was one of six children blessed to Aniello and Restituta Scotti. For the last year of her life, she resided at the Kaplan Hospice Community, where she received compassionate care from her nurses, doctor, aides, and Sr. Anne, exemplifying the power of kindness. Her remarkable career began in 1952 at the New York Marshalls Office, where she met her beloved husband Frank, and they married in 1957. Mom selflessly raised her four children, Melanie, Neil (Georgette), Frank (Donna), and Margaret, instilling in them the values of love and resilience. As a dedicated employee of NY Telephone for 20 years, she passionately assisted customers in the business office, particularly the blind and hearing impaired, forming lasting bonds with many senior customers, retiring in 1989. Her unwavering care and concern for others led her to a part-time position at the Orange County Dept of Social Services, supporting senior citizens, and later, part-time work at First Care Medical in Monroe. Her grandchildren Kevin, Danielle, Brendan, Neil, Ryan, Andreas, Lily, Nicole, and great-grandchildren Luna and Aurora, were blessed to have her as their guiding light, their "Grandma." Her gift to everyone she met was a reflection of her compassionate soul, nurturing not only her family, but countless other children and friends who knew her as Grandma and Mom, inspiring all of us with her unwavering love and generosity. Though her journey was marked by challenges, she faced them with courage and dignity, leaving us with a legacy of beautiful memories and unconditional love. Visitation will be Wednesday, March 12 from 4:00 to 8:00 PM at Donovan Funeral Home, Inc, 82 South Church Street, Goshen, NY. A Mass of Christian burial to Celebrate her life will be held 10:00 am on Thursday, March 13, 2025 at Sacred Heart Church, 26 Still Road, Monroe, NY. Burial will follow in in St Mary's Cemetery, Washingtonville.
